Sec. 209.0052. ASSOCIATION CONTRACTS.

(a)This section does not apply to a contract entered into by an association during the development period.

Legislative History

Added by Acts 2013, 83rd Leg., R.S., Ch. 863 (H.B. 503 ), Sec. 2, eff. September 1, 2013. Amended by: Acts 2021, 87th Leg., R.S., Ch. 951 (S.B. 1588 ), Sec. 13, eff. September 1, 2021.
